We are advising Crane NXT on the transaction

Davis Polk is advising Crane NXT, Co. on its acquisition of a 30% minority stake in Antares Vision S.p.A. from Regolo S.p.A. and Sargas S.r.L. at a price of €5.00 per share for a total consideration of approximately €120 million. After closing of the transaction, Crane NXT will launch a mandatory tender offer in Italy for the remaining publicly traded shares of Antares Vision at the same price of €5.00 per share, at a total enterprise value of €445 million. Upon completion of the mandatory tender offer Crane NXT will implement steps aimed at delisting Antares Vision and will acquire the remaining stake owned by Regolo. As a result of the transaction, Antares Vision will become a subsidiary of Crane NXT. The overall transaction is expected to close in the first half of 2026, subject to customary closing conditions and regulatory approvals.

Crane NXT is a premier industrial technology company that provides trusted technology solutions to secure, detect and authenticate what matters most to its customers. Through its industry-leading businesses, Crane NXT provides customers with advanced technologies to secure high-value physical products, sophisticated detection equipment and systems, and proprietary products and services that protect brand identity. Crane NXT’s approximately 5,000 employees help its customers protect their most important assets and ensure secure, seamless transactions around the world every day.

Antares Vision is an Italian multinational company that ensures product safety and supply chain transparency through innovative technologies for quality control, end-to-end traceability and integrated data management. The company operates primarily in the life sciences and food and beverage sectors and is present in more than 60 countries, employs approximately 1,200 people and has a network of more than 40 international partners. Antares Vision has been listed on the Euronext STAR Milan segment (EXM, AV:IM) since 2021.
